Lemon Tree care requirements
These care conditions are most relevant to slow growth in Lemon Tree. Check each one as a potential cause.
light_mode
Light
Full sun — minimum 8 hours.
science
Fertiliser
Specialist citrus fertiliser monthly in growing season.
thermometer
Temperature
10–38°C (50–100°F). Bring inside when below 7°C.

How to diagnose slow growth in Lemon Tree
Assess light levels, feeding schedule, and pot size.
healing
How to treat slow growth in Lemon Tree
Move to brighter spot. Feed regularly during growing season. Repot if root-bound.
shield
Preventing slow growth in Lemon Tree
Regular feeding. Adequate light. Annual pot size check.
